Job Details

A growing food manufacturing company in the Marystown, Minnesota area is seeking an experienced Food Safety & Quality Assurance Manager to lead and strengthen its food safety, quality, and regulatory compliance programs.

This is a key leadership opportunity for a food safety professional who enjoys working closely with production and operations teams and has a strong understanding of HACCP, SQF, PCQI, food microbiology, auditing, and continuous improvement.

The ideal candidate will be both strategic and hands-on, with the ability to take ownership of food safety programs while helping foster a strong culture of quality and accountability throughout the organization.

What You'll Do
Lead and manage food safety and quality assurance programs to ensure compliance with applicable local, state, federal, and international regulations.
Develop, implement, maintain, and continuously improve HACCP, SQF, and other food safety and quality programs.
Oversee the HACCP program, including identification, evaluation, and control of food safety hazards.
Conduct food safety and quality risk assessments and develop preventive measures to mitigate identified risks.
Lead internal audits, inspections, and food safety assessments.
Identify potential risks and ensure corrective and preventive actions are effectively implemented.
Partner closely with production and operations teams to integrate food safety and quality standards throughout manufacturing processes.
Provide training, guidance, and ongoing support to employees regarding food safety, quality assurance, and regulatory requirements.
Investigate customer complaints and food quality or safety issues, determine root causes, and implement appropriate corrective actions.
Maintain accurate documentation and records related to food safety, quality assurance, audits, inspections, and corrective actions.
Stay current on regulatory changes, industry trends, and emerging food safety practices.
Update policies, procedures, and programs as needed to maintain compliance and operational excellence.
Promote a culture of continuous improvement and accountability surrounding food safety and quality.

What We're Looking For
Bachelor's degree in Food Science, Food Microbiology, Food Processing, or a related field.
5+ years of food safety and quality assurance experience within a food manufacturing environment.
Strong knowledge of HACCP, SQF, PCQI, and food safety management systems.
HACCP certification required.
PCQI certification required.
SQF Practitioner certification preferred.
Proven experience managing food safety and quality assurance programs.
Experience conducting audits, inspections, risk assessments, and corrective/preventive actions.
Strong understanding of food microbiology and its application within food manufacturing.
Excellent problem-solving and decision-making abilities.
Strong communication, leadership, and interpersonal skills.
Ability to collaborate effectively with production and operations in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.
Proficiency with quality assurance software, documentation systems, and related tools preferred.
